Orenda Financial Marks 9 Years With ₹1,000 Crore Milestone

Orenda Financial Served 10,000+ Borrowers Through A Network of 50+ Lenders

Orenda Financial Services has completed nine years of operations after facilitating more than ₹1,000 crore in loan disbursements for over 10,000 businesses and individuals. The company, which began in Rajkot in 2017, is entering its tenth year with a greater focus on technology, digital lending and its network of banking and NBFC partners.

Orenda currently works with more than 50 banking and NBFC partners and over 450 channel partners. Its lending portfolio includes business loans, mortgage loans, personal loans, home loans and loans against property.

The company marked the anniversary on August 24, 2026, by announcing several technology and business initiatives. These include an in-house customer relationship management system and lending platform, a Bank Statement Analysis tool, a new brand identity and a new website that is being introduced in beta.

From Rajkot To A Wider Lending Network

Orenda was founded in Rajkot in 2017 and has built its business around connecting borrowers with banks and NBFCs. Its role is different from that of a traditional bank because it works across a network of lenders and channel partners to help customers find suitable credit options.

The company’s early focus was on using technology to reduce paperwork and improve the way loan proposals are assessed. Its stated technology plans have included tools such as document processing, bank statement evaluation and credit information checks.

The wider lending market has also moved towards greater use of digital systems. The Reserve Bank of India has introduced rules for digital lending that cover areas such as borrower disclosures, data collection, loan servicing and the role of lending service providers. The rules require regulated lenders to give borrowers a Key Fact Statement showing the annualised cost of a digital loan before the loan agreement is signed.

For companies working around digital credit, technology therefore has to improve speed without weakening transparency or borrower protection.

New Technology Systems Take Centre Stage

For its ninth anniversary, Orenda has introduced an in-house CRM and lending platform. The system is intended to manage the loan process from application through to disbursement and improve coordination between the company, its employees and channel partners.

The company has also developed a proprietary Bank Statement Analysis tool. Bank statements are an important part of many lending assessments because they can provide information about income, cash flow and financial activity.

Orenda’s technology plans come at a time when India’s financial sector is using more digital data to assess credit applications. The RBI’s Unified Lending Interface, or ULI, was designed to connect lenders and data service providers through standardised technology links. By March 31, 2025, the platform had 44 lenders using more than 60 data services across 12 loan journeys, including MSME lending.

The development is relevant to small businesses, which can often face difficulties in presenting financial information in a form lenders can assess quickly. The Ministry of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ises has also published a guide aimed at helping MSME borrowers understand lending rules, procedures and their rights.

Focus on MSMEs And Retail Borrowers

Orenda says its lending activity covers both businesses and individual customers. Its MSME focus places the company in a large credit market where access to formal finance remains an important issue for smaller enterprises.

Government-backed credit programmes have also been designed to improve lending to smaller businesses. Under the Credit Guarantee Scheme for Micro and Small Enterprises, eligible lenders can provide collateral-free credit supported by a guarantee mechanism. The scheme aims to strengthen the flow of credit to the MSE sector.

The government increased the credit guarantee cover for micro and small enterprises from ₹5 crore to ₹10 crore in the 2025-26 Budget, with the government saying the change could support additional credit of ₹1.5 lakh crore over five years.

Against this backdrop, lending platforms that can process financial information efficiently may have a role in helping borrowers and lenders manage applications. The actual loan decision, however, remains with the regulated lender.

Orenda Holdings Association

Another development announced by Orenda is its association with Orenda Holdings as an equity partner. The company said the relationship will be used to explore opportunities in Gujarat’s affordable housing sector.

Orenda Holdings describes itself as an Ahmedabad-based group with interests that include finance, real estate, legal services, digital businesses and other ventures. Its wider activities give the new association a connection to areas beyond lending.

The affordable housing segment is closely linked to the availability of housing finance and property-backed credit. Orenda’s existing products include home loans, mortgage loans and loans against property, making housing finance one of the areas covered by its lending network.

Leadership Looks To The Next ₹1,000 Crore

Harsh Bhojani, Founder and Managing Director of Orenda Financial Services, said the business started with a small office in Rajkot and has taken nine years to reach the ₹1,000-crore disbursement mark.

“Nine years ago, Orenda was a small office in Rajkot. Today, with the support of our partners, we are creating and deploying tools that bring greater efficiency and capability to the lending ecosystem. It took us nine years to reach our first ₹1,000 crore in disbursements. We believe the journey towards the next ₹1,000 crore will take significantly less time.”

Sanket Parekh, Chief Business Officer and Executive Director, said the company plans to put greater emphasis on digital lending, shorter turnaround times and wider access to credit.

The anniversary celebrations also recognised Orenda’s first employee, who has remained with the organisation since its beginning.

As Orenda enters its tenth year, its stated priorities are further investment in technology, lending processes, partner support and new products. The company also plans to expand its presence across Gujarat and into other markets.

The ₹1,000-crore figure marks the scale reached since 2017. The next phase will depend on how effectively Orenda can use its technology, lender relationships and customer network while meeting the standards that increasingly govern digital lending in India.
